Greenfly powers real-time digital media workflows for the world's biggest sports leagues, teams, and brands. Our platform moves photos and video from the field to athletes' and fans' feeds in seconds. We support high-volume media capture, organization, and distribution, for game day operations when latency and reliability actually matter.

We're looking for a Front-End Engineer to help build the web experience at the heart of that platform.

What You'll Do
  • Design, build, and maintain features in our Angular web application using TypeScript, RxJS, and NgRx.
  • Build reusable, responsive UI components that handle media-heavy, real-time workflows at scale.
  • Partner with product managers, designers, and platform engineers to shape features from concept through launch, including the API contracts behind them.
  • Embrace and advocate for standards and best practices to deliver high-performing web applications.

Requirements
  • 5+ years of professional software development experience building web interfaces.
  • 3+ years with Angular and TypeScript, including strong command of RxJS and component-based architecture.
  • Experience with NgRx or other state-management patterns.
  • A track record of building and maintaining reusable UI component libraries with responsive design principles.
  • Solid testing habits: unit tests and end-to-end tests as part of everyday development, including tests for AI-assisted changes.
  • Strong eye for user-centered design and the ability to collaborate closely with designers.
  • Clear communicator who can work independently and turn product goals into shipped features.

What you need to know about the San Francisco Tech Scene

San Francisco and the surrounding Bay Area attracts more startup funding than any other region in the world. Home to Stanford University and UC Berkeley, leading VC firms and several of the world’s most valuable companies, the Bay Area is the place to go for anyone looking to make it big in the tech industry. That said, San Francisco has a lot to offer beyond technology thanks to a thriving art and music scene, excellent food and a short drive to several of the country’s most beautiful recreational areas.

Key Facts About San Francisco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 365,500; 13.9%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Google, Apple, Salesforce, Meta
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, fintech, consumer technology, software
  • Funding Landscape: $50.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Sequoia Capital, Andreessen Horowitz, Bessemer Venture Partners,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Kleiner Perkins
  • Research Centers and Universities: Stanford University; University of California, Berkeley; University of San Francisco; Santa Clara University; Ames Research Center; Center for AI Safety; California Institute for Regenerative Medicine
